2015-04-26net: rfs: fix crash in get_rps_cpus()Eric Dumazet
Commit 567e4b79731c ("net: rfs: add hash collision detection") had one mistake : RPS_NO_CPU is no longer the marker for invalid cpu in set_rps_cpu() and get_rps_cpu(), as @next_cpu was the result of an AND with rps_cpu_mask This bug showed up on a host with 72 cpus : next_cpu was 0x7f, and the code was trying to access percpu data of an non existent cpu. In a follow up patch, we might get rid of compares against nr_cpu_ids, if we init the tables with 0. This is silly to test for a very unlikely condition that exists only shortly after table initialization, as we got rid of rps_reset_sock_flow() and similar functions that were writing this RPS_NO_CPU magic value at flow dismantle : When table is old enough, it never contains this value anymore. 2015-04-26Btrfs: fill ->last_trans for delayed inode in btrfs_fill_inode.Yang Dongsheng
We need to fill inode when we found a node for it in delayed_nodes_tree. But we did not fill the ->last_trans currently, it will cause the test of xfstest/generic/311 fail. Scenario of the 311 is shown as below: Problem: (1). test_fd = open(fname, O_RDWR|O_DIRECT) (2). pwrite(test_fd, buf, 4096, 0) (3). close(test_fd) (4). drop_all_caches() <-------- "echo 3 > /proc/sys/vm/drop_caches" (5). test_fd = open(fname, O_RDWR|O_DIRECT) (6). fsync(test_fd); <-------- we did not get the correct log entry for the file Reason: When we re-open this file in (5), we would find a node in delayed_nodes_tree and fill the inode we are lookup with the information. But the ->last_trans is not filled, then the fsync() will check the ->last_trans and found it's 0 then say this inode is already in our tree which is commited, not recording the extents for it. Fix: This patch fill the ->last_trans properly and set the runtime_flags if needed in this situation. Then we can get the log entries we expected after (6) and generic/311 passed. 2015-04-26btrfs: fix race on ENOMEM in alloc_extent_bufferOmar Sandoval
Consider the following interleaving of overlapping calls to alloc_extent_buffer: Call 1: - Successfully allocates a few pages with find_or_create_page - find_or_create_page fails, goto free_eb - Unlocks the allocated pages Call 2: - Calls find_or_create_page and gets a page in call 1's extent_buffer - Finds that the page is already associated with an extent_buffer - Grabs a reference to the half-written extent_buffer and calls mark_extent_buffer_accessed on it mark_extent_buffer_accessed will then try to call mark_page_accessed on a null page and panic. The fix is to decrement the reference count on the half-written extent_buffer before unlocking the pages so call 2 won't use it. We should also set exists = NULL in the case that we don't use exists to avoid accidentally returning a freed extent_buffer in an error case. 2015-04-24direct-io: only inc/dec inode->i_dio_count for file systemsJens Axboe
do_blockdev_direct_IO() increments and decrements the inode ->i_dio_count for each IO operation. It does this to protect against truncate of a file. Block devices don't need this sort of protection. For a capable multiqueue setup, this atomic int is the only shared state between applications accessing the device for O_DIRECT, and it presents a scaling wall for that. In my testing, as much as 30% of system time is spent incrementing and decrementing this value. A mixed read/write workload improved from ~2.5M IOPS to ~9.6M IOPS, with better latencies too. Before: clat percentiles (usec): | 1.00th=[ 33], 5.00th=[ 34], 10.00th=[ 34], 20.00th=[ 34], | 30.00th=[ 34], 40.00th=[ 34], 50.00th=[ 35], 60.00th=[ 35], | 70.00th=[ 35], 80.00th=[ 35], 90.00th=[ 37], 95.00th=[ 80], | 99.00th=[ 98], 99.50th=[ 151], 99.90th=[ 155], 99.95th=[ 155], | 99.99th=[ 165] After: clat percentiles (usec): | 1.00th=[ 95], 5.00th=[ 108], 10.00th=[ 129], 20.00th=[ 149], | 30.00th=[ 155], 40.00th=[ 161], 50.00th=[ 167], 60.00th=[ 171], | 70.00th=[ 177], 80.00th=[ 185], 90.00th=[ 201], 95.00th=[ 270], | 99.00th=[ 390], 99.50th=[ 398], 99.90th=[ 418], 99.95th=[ 422], | 99.99th=[ 438] In other setups, Robert Elliott reported seeing good performance improvements: https://lkml.org/lkml/2015/4/3/557 The more applications accessing the device, the worse it gets. Add a new direct-io flags, DIO_SKIP_DIO_COUNT, which tells do_blockdev_direct_IO() that it need not worry about incrementing or decrementing the inode i_dio_count for this caller. 2015-04-24inet: fix possible panic in reqsk_queue_unlink()Eric Dumazet
[ 3897.923145] BUG: unable to handle kernel NULL pointer dereference at 0000000000000080 [ 3897.931025] IP: [<ffffffffa9f27686>] reqsk_timer_handler+0x1a6/0x243 There is a race when reqsk_timer_handler() and tcp_check_req() call inet_csk_reqsk_queue_unlink() on the same req at the same time. Before commit fa76ce7328b2 ("inet: get rid of central tcp/dccp listener timer"), listener spinlock was held and race could not happen. To solve this bug, we change reqsk_queue_unlink() to not assume req must be found, and we return a status, to conditionally release a refcount on the request sock. This also means tcp_check_req() in non fastopen case might or not consume req refcount, so tcp_v6_hnd_req() & tcp_v4_hnd_req() have to properly handle this. (Same remark for dccp_check_req() and its callers) inet_csk_reqsk_queue_drop() is now too big to be inlined, as it is called 4 times in tcp and 3 times in dccp. 2015-04-24rhashtable: don't attempt to grow when at max_sizeJohannes Berg
The conversion of mac80211's station table to rhashtable had a bug that I found by accident in code review, that hadn't been found as rhashtable apparently managed to have a maximum hash chain length of one (!) in all our testing. In order to test the bug and verify the fix I set my rhashtable's max_size very low (4) in order to force getting hash collisions. At that point, rhashtable WARNed in rhashtable_insert_rehash() but didn't actually reject the hash table insertion. This caused it to lose insertions - my master list of stations would have 9 entries, but the rhashtable only had 5. This may warrant a deeper look, but that WARN_ON() just shouldn't happen. Fix this by not returning true from rht_grow_above_100() when the rhashtable's max_size has been reached - in this case the user is explicitly configuring it to be at most that big, so even if it's now above 100% it shouldn't attempt to resize. This fixes the "lost insertion" issue and consequently allows my code to display its error (and verify my fix for it.)
